> It is my understanding that there must be a sovereign AND a consort.
That's not what _Corpora_ says. _Corpora_ requires the Crown Lists
choose a prospective Sovereign & Consort, who take, at their Coronation,
the titles of King and Queen. _Corpora_ requires each kingdom to
provide in its Kingdom Law procedures to deal with the failure of
the King, Queen, Crown Prince or Crown Princess.
I hope
> the Midrealm isn't allowed to have one or the other. That would bode ill for
> many, as there have been many who might have wanted to just "divorce" their
> consort sometime before or during the reign, but have been prevented from
> doing so by the requirement that the king and queen agree to such things as
> peerages and laws.
Loathe as I am to dispute a former Steward of the SCA, especially one
for whom I have so much respect, my read of _Corpora_ is that Midrealm
Law is fully within the restrictions and requirements of Corpora.
Indeed, Ansteorran Law holds that if we lose a King or a Queen, the
other continues alone and completes the reign.
